Main Responsibilities and Expectations
You are expected to carry out a range of cleaning tasks, including sweeping, mopping, vacuuming, and sanitizing various areas in the facility.
The job requires you to ensure restrooms are clean and properly stocked, along with regular waste disposal and cleaning of kitchen areas.
Detailed cleaning of surfaces, furniture, and glass is required, along with routine use of equipment such as vacuums and floor buffers when needed.
Reporting any maintenance concerns to your supervisor and maintaining cleaning supplies inventory will be part of your responsibilities.
Safety is important, so you must ensure compliance with all procedures and use necessary protective equipment during your shift.
